Conclusion
Daiwa 20 Fuego LT 4000-CXHX edges out Shimano Sahara FJ 1000X with slightly better overall performance, especially on the line retrieve per crank (99 centimeter / 38.98 inch) and the maximum drag (12kg / 26,46lbs). Still, Shimano Sahara FJ 1000X holds its own with strengths like a durability of 7 out of 10 and a weight of 205g / 7,23oz, making it a solid choice depending on your preferences and fishing needs.
